Fixing Microsoft Access 'Can't Find Language DLL Msain.dll' Error: A Step-by-Step Guide

...

Microsoft Access is a powerful tool that allows users to create and manage databases with ease. However, sometimes errors can occur that prevent the program from running smoothly. One such error is when Microsoft Access can't find language DLL msain.dll. This can be frustrating for users who rely on the program for their daily tasks. In this article, we will explore the causes of this error and provide solutions to help you get back to using Microsoft Access without any issues.

First and foremost, it's important to understand what DLL files are and why they are important for Microsoft Access to function properly. DLL stands for Dynamic Link Library, which is a collection of small programs that can be used by multiple applications at the same time. These files contain code that can be called upon by other programs to perform specific tasks. In the case of Microsoft Access, msain.dll is a language DLL file that contains resources for different languages supported by the program.

So, what causes the error message Can't find language DLL msain.dll to appear? There are several reasons why this might happen. One common cause is when the file becomes corrupted or goes missing due to a virus or malware infection. Another reason could be that the file has been moved to a different location or accidentally deleted. It's also possible that there is a problem with the Windows registry, which is responsible for storing information about DLL files and their locations.

If you're experiencing this error message, don't panic. There are several solutions you can try to fix the issue. One option is to reinstall Microsoft Access to replace any missing or damaged files. You can also try running a virus scan to check for any malware that may be causing the problem. Another solution is to manually copy the msain.dll file from another computer running the same version of Microsoft Access and paste it into your own system folder.

It's also worth checking if there are any updates available for Microsoft Access or Windows. Sometimes, updates can fix bugs and errors that are causing problems with the program. You can check for updates by going to the Windows Update section in your settings or by visiting the Microsoft website.

If none of these solutions work, you may need to seek help from a professional. Microsoft Access is a complex program that requires a certain level of expertise to troubleshoot effectively. There are many online forums and support groups where you can seek advice from other users who may have experienced the same issue.

In conclusion, the error message Can't find language DLL msain.dll can be a frustrating problem for Microsoft Access users. However, with the right solutions, you can quickly get back to using the program without any issues. Remember to always keep your software up to date and run regular virus scans to prevent future problems. If you're still having trouble, don't hesitate to seek help from a professional or online support group.


Introduction

Microsoft Access is a popular database management system that allows users to create, edit, and manage databases. However, like any software, Access can encounter errors or issues that can hinder its performance. One such error is the Can't Find Language DLL msain.dll error, which can be frustrating and confusing for users. In this article, we will explore this error in detail and provide solutions to fix it.

What Causes the Can't Find Language DLL msain.dll Error?

This error occurs when Microsoft Access cannot find the language DLL file msain.dll. The msain.dll file is a language-specific resource file that provides support for internationalization features in Access. When this file is missing or corrupt, Access will not be able to load properly, resulting in the error message.

Corrupt Installation Files or Registry Entries

One of the most common causes of this error is corrupt installation files or registry entries. This can happen when installing Access, or when making changes to the system that affect the registry. If the installation files are damaged or the registry entries are incorrect, Access may not be able to locate the msain.dll file, resulting in the error.

Anti-Virus Software Interference

Another cause of this error is anti-virus software interference. Some anti-virus software can detect the msain.dll file as a threat and quarantine or delete it. This can cause Access to fail to locate the file, resulting in the error message.

Microsoft Office Update Issues

In some cases, this error can occur due to issues with Microsoft Office updates. Updates can sometimes break certain functionalities in Access, including the ability to locate the msain.dll file. This can result in the error message appearing when you try to launch Access.

How to Fix the Can't Find Language DLL msain.dll Error

Now that we know what causes the error, let's explore some solutions to fix it.

Reinstall Microsoft Access

If the cause of the error is corrupt installation files or registry entries, reinstalling Microsoft Access may be the solution. Uninstall Access from your computer and then download and install the latest version from the Microsoft website. This will replace any damaged installation files and registry entries, allowing Access to locate the msain.dll file.

Restore the msain.dll File

If the msain.dll file has been deleted or quarantined by your anti-virus software, you can try restoring it. Check your anti-virus software quarantine folder or restore the file from a backup if you have one. Once the file is restored, Access should be able to locate it and function properly.

Repair Microsoft Office

If the error occurs due to issues with Microsoft Office updates, repairing Microsoft Office may be the solution. Go to the Control Panel and select Programs and Features. Find Microsoft Office in the list and select Change. Choose the Repair option and follow the on-screen instructions to repair Microsoft Office.

Update Windows

Sometimes, outdated Windows files can cause issues with Microsoft Access, including the Can't Find Language DLL msain.dll error. Make sure your Windows operating system is up to date by going to Settings > Update & Security > Windows Update. Click Check for Updates and install any available updates.

Conclusion

The Can't Find Language DLL msain.dll error can be frustrating for Microsoft Access users. However, by understanding the causes of the error and implementing the solutions outlined in this article, you can get back to using Access without any issues. Whether it's reinstalling Access, restoring the msain.dll file, repairing Microsoft Office, or updating Windows, there are several ways to fix this error and get back to managing your databases.

Understanding the Error Code Can't Find Language DLL MSAIN.DLL in Microsoft Access

If you're a Microsoft Access user, you may have encountered the dreaded error message that reads Can't Find Language DLL MSAIN.DLL. This error code can be frustrating and confusing, as it can prevent you from accessing your important data and files. However, with a bit of understanding and troubleshooting, you can fix this issue and get back to using Microsoft Access without any problems.

Potential Causes of the Can't Find Language DLL MSAIN.DLL Error Code in Microsoft Access

There are several potential causes of the Can't Find Language DLL MSAIN.DLL error code in Microsoft Access. One of the most common reasons is missing or corrupted files. If any necessary files are missing or damaged, Microsoft Access may not be able to function properly, leading to this error code.Another cause could be malware or spyware affecting your computer. These types of malicious software can interfere with Microsoft Access and cause errors like Can't Find Language DLL MSAIN.DLL. Additionally, outdated software or a problem with the Windows registry could also be to blame.

Checking for Missing or Corrupted Files in Microsoft Access

To start troubleshooting this error code, you should first check for missing or corrupted files in Microsoft Access. Navigate to the folder where Microsoft Access is installed and look for the MSAIN.DLL file. If it's missing or damaged, you can try repairing or reinstalling Microsoft Access to replace the file.

Running Anti-Virus Software to Detect and Fix the Error

If the issue is caused by malware or spyware, running anti-virus software can help detect and fix the problem. Make sure you have a reputable anti-virus program installed on your computer and run a full scan to check for any potential threats.

Updating Microsoft Office to Resolve the Issue

Outdated software can sometimes cause errors like Can't Find Language DLL MSAIN.DLL. To fix this issue, make sure you have the latest version of Microsoft Office installed on your computer. Check for updates and install any available ones to ensure your software is up-to-date.

Repairing or Reinstalling Microsoft Access to Fix the Error

If none of the above solutions work, you may need to repair or reinstall Microsoft Access to fix the error code. This will replace any missing or damaged files and ensure that the software is functioning properly.

Troubleshooting with the Windows Registry Editor

Sometimes, a problem with the Windows registry can cause errors like Can't Find Language DLL MSAIN.DLL. If you're comfortable using the Windows Registry Editor, you can try troubleshooting the issue there. However, be cautious when making changes to the registry, as it can affect the overall performance of your computer.

Scanning for Malware or Spyware That May be Affecting Microsoft Access

As previously mentioned, malware and spyware can cause errors in Microsoft Access. If you suspect that your computer has been infected, use anti-virus software to scan for any potential threats and eliminate them.

Seeking Professional Assistance for Advanced Fixes

If you're unable to resolve the issue on your own, seeking professional assistance is always an option. A skilled IT technician or Microsoft Access expert can diagnose and fix more advanced issues that may be causing the error code.

Preventative Measures to Avoid Future Occurrences of the Can't Find Language DLL MSAIN.DLL Error Code

To avoid encountering the Can't Find Language DLL MSAIN.DLL error code in the future, there are some preventative measures you can take. These include regularly updating your software, running anti-virus software, and backing up your important files and data. Additionally, be cautious when downloading and installing new software, as this can sometimes lead to issues with Microsoft Access.

Microsoft Access Can't Find Language Dll Msain Dll

The Problem

Microsoft Access is a powerful tool used by businesses to manage their data. However, sometimes users may encounter an error message that says Can't find Language DLL msain.dll. This error can be frustrating and confusing, especially if you're not sure what it means.

The Cause

The cause of this error is typically due to a corrupted or missing file. In this case, the msain.dll file is either missing or damaged, which is preventing Microsoft Access from running properly.

The Solution

Fortunately, there are several solutions to this problem.

  1. Reinstall Microsoft Office: One solution is to reinstall Microsoft Office. This will replace any missing or corrupted files, including msain.dll.
  2. Update Microsoft Office: Another solution is to update Microsoft Office to the latest version. This can often fix any bugs or errors that may be causing the issue.
  3. Manually replace the msain.dll file: If you're comfortable with working with system files, you can manually replace the msain.dll file. You can download a new copy of the file and place it in the appropriate location on your computer.

Conclusion

While encountering an error like Can't find Language DLL msain.dll can be frustrating, there are solutions available. By reinstalling or updating Microsoft Office, or manually replacing the msain.dll file, you can get Microsoft Access up and running again. If you're unsure about any of these solutions, it's always best to consult with a professional.

Keywords Definition
Microsoft Access A database management system developed by Microsoft.
msain.dll A file that is part of the Microsoft Office suite.
Reinstall To install again; to replace an existing installation.
Update To bring up to date; to make current.
Manually replace To replace a file by hand, without using an automated tool.

Conclusion

Thank you for taking the time to read through this article on Microsoft Access Can T Find Language Dll Msain Dll. We hope that the information provided has been helpful in solving any issues you may be experiencing with this error message.

It is important to note that this error can occur for a variety of reasons, from corrupt or missing files to outdated software versions. However, with the right troubleshooting steps and resources, it is possible to resolve the issue and get back to using Microsoft Access as intended.

If you are still encountering difficulties after following the steps outlined in this article, we encourage you to seek additional support from Microsoft or a qualified IT professional. They can provide further guidance and assistance in resolving the issue and ensuring that your system is running smoothly.

As always, it is important to keep your software and systems up to date, as this can help prevent issues like the Can T Find Language Dll Msain Dll error from occurring in the first place. Regular updates and maintenance can go a long way in keeping your technology running smoothly and efficiently.

We hope that this article has been informative and helpful in addressing any issues you may be experiencing with Microsoft Access. Thank you for visiting our blog, and we wish you the best of luck in resolving any technical difficulties you may encounter in the future.

Remember, there is always help available if you need it, so don't hesitate to reach out if you need further assistance or guidance.

Thank you again for visiting, and we hope to see you again soon!


People Also Ask about Microsoft Access Can't Find Language Dll Msain Dll

What is MSAIN.dll?

MSAIN.dll is a Dynamic Link Library (DLL) file that contains functions and resources for Microsoft Access. It helps in the integration of Microsoft Access with other Microsoft Office applications such as Excel, Word, and PowerPoint.

Why am I getting an error message Can't find language DLL MSAIN.dll in Microsoft Access?

If you are getting an error message Can't find language DLL MSAIN.dll while using Microsoft Access, it means that your system is unable to locate the MSAIN.dll file. This error can occur due to various reasons such as:

  • The MSAIN.dll file is missing or corrupted.
  • Microsoft Access is not installed correctly.
  • The Microsoft Office installation is damaged.
  • The Windows registry is corrupt.

How to fix the Can't find language DLL MSAIN.dll error in Microsoft Access?

To fix the Can't find language DLL MSAIN.dll error in Microsoft Access, you can try the following solutions:

  1. Reinstall Microsoft Office: This will help to replace the missing or corrupted MSAIN.dll file.
  2. Repair Microsoft Office: You can repair your Microsoft Office installation through the Control Panel to fix any damaged files or settings.
  3. Update Windows: Updating Windows to the latest version can help to resolve any system-related issues.
  4. Run a virus scan: A virus or malware infection can cause problems with DLL files. Running a virus scan can help to detect and remove any malicious programs.
  5. Manually register the MSAIN.dll file: You can try manually registering the MSAIN.dll file using the Command Prompt. Open the Command Prompt as an administrator and type regsvr32 msain.dll and press Enter.

Can I download the MSAIN.dll file?

No, it is not recommended to download the MSAIN.dll file from any third-party website. Downloading DLL files from untrusted sources can be risky and may cause more harm than good. It is best to fix the Can't find language DLL MSAIN.dll error by following the solutions mentioned above.